Sinclair's Morning Ritual: NMN with Yogurt
The cornerstone of Sinclair's NMN intake is his morning routine. As detailed in his book Lifespan, he takes a daily amount of NMN. Rather than simply swallowing capsules, he mixes the powder into his breakfast yogurt.
He has explained that the fat content in the yogurt, or a similar fat source like olive oil, helps enhance the bioavailability of other supplements he takes alongside NMN, such as resveratrol. While NMN is water-soluble and can be absorbed without food, this combination is a key part of his comprehensive approach.
The Science Behind the Synergy
Sinclair's practice of combining NMN with other compounds is rooted in the scientific understanding of cellular energy and aging. NMN serves as a direct precursor to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ide (NAD+), a vital coenzyme that declines with age. He views resveratrol as the "accelerator" for sirtuin genes, which are linked to longevity, while NMN acts as the "fuel" needed for that process. By taking them together, he aims to create a synergistic effect that boosts cellular function.
Here is a closer look at the key components involved:
- NMN (Nicotinamide Mononucleotide): This is the direct precursor molecule for NAD+ synthesis. Boosting NAD+ levels is potentially crucial because NAD+ is involved in hundreds of metabolic processes, including energy production and DNA repair.
- Resveratrol: This plant-based polyphenol, found in grapes and other plants, is known to activate sirtuins. Sirtuins are a family of proteins that regulate cellular health and are thought to have a significant role in longevity.
- Yogurt or Fat Source: While NMN is absorbed without fat, resveratrol is fat-soluble. Mixing it with a fat-rich food like yogurt can potentially improve the absorption of resveratrol, allowing it to work more effectively alongside NMN.
The Importance of Consistency and Methylation
Sinclair emphasizes that consistency is a critical factor for his longevity regimen. Taking the supplements daily, often in the morning, may help ensure a steady supply of these compounds to support cellular processes. He also includes other supplements to counteract potential effects.
For example, NMN supplementation can potentially affect methyl groups in the body as it's processed and excreted. To potentially prevent this, Sinclair also takes trimethylglycine (TMG), a methyl donor, as a precautionary measure.

Other Factors in Sinclair's Protocol
It's crucial to understand that NMN is just one piece of Sinclair's overall health and longevity strategy. He combines his supplement regimen with several key lifestyle practices:
- Intermittent Fasting: He often follows a time-restricted eating schedule, such as a 16:8 or 20:4 pattern, which supports cellular cleanup processes like autophagy.
- Exercise: His routine includes a mix of strength training, cardio, and high-intensity interval training (HIIT) to improve cardiovascular health and mitochondrial function.
- Diet: He generally eats a plant-based diet, avoiding excess meat, sugar, and refined carbohydrates. He also abstains from alcohol.
- Regular Monitoring: Sinclair uses continuous glucose monitors and gets frequent blood tests to track his biomarkers and assess the potential effectiveness of his protocol.
